Mobile App Developments Q/NA Series is the most collective question answers collection, so don’t miss it and read the article to learn more///

I am very amazed that I can help you by answering your questions, people are great and I’m very happy to share our thoughts

What is a grocery mobile app development?

{ Mobile App Developments Q/NA Series }

Covid-19 has brought about a devastating impact on the lives of people. Amidst quarantine, travel restrictions and lockdown, cities across the world have a deserted look just like the heart-wrenching set of a post-apocalypse TV show.

This is the reason why multi-niche delivery apps are gaining popularity. The main reason behind the success is providing different delivery options in one app, giving users the flexibility and convenience that the services are accessible through a single app.

Digital Technology: New Normal for Grocery Stores

Due to the rapid increase of CoronaVirus, people have become cautious and reluctant about visiting traditional grocery stores which requires physical contact with products.

A key driver during this pandemic, it turns out, is digital technology.

Grocery Mobile App Development Features

    • Cart Sharing & Shopping List: List of products customers are looking to buy and creating shopping lists.
    • Auto-suggest Search: Search products by typing keywords or phrases into the search box without navigating the app.
    • Push Notifications: Get the latest update on products, discounts and deals as notifications or alerts.
  • Order Tracking and Status: Order tracking and status feature providing real-time details.
  • Coupon Codes & Special Deals: Giving coupon codes to your customers on their every purchase and special deals on festivals to increase sales on online grocery mobile apps.
  • Reviews and Ratings: User-generated content such as customer’s reviews, comments, discussions type of content act as social proof to build trust among users.
  • Product comparisons: Option to research and compare products, prices, quality to find products without leaving the apps.
  • Secure payment options: Multiple and secure payment methods allowing customers to pay by cash, credit & debit cards, digital wallets, PayPal, Net banking.

What influences the cost of mobile app development?

The more complex the application, the more expensive it is. Custom scripts, the number of screens and application states, buttons, fields, the amount of business logic, and the server infrastructure require many hours of development and subsequent testing. Here are the most expensive components.

Stages of creating a mobile application: analytics; technical task; engineering and design; development; testing and stabilization; publication in stores; support and development.

Screens, actions, and data in the app. Each screen must be thought of: choose the optimal arrangement of elements and buttons, think over the business logic, and take care of the user’s convenience. Behind this is a lot of work of different studio specialists – from the project manager to the tester.

Custom scripts. User interaction begins with launching the application. The user registers go through the authorization procedure, creates and edits a personal profile, sets up notifications, and then makes a purchase. Each of these elements can be implemented in different ways.

Using the built-in functions of smartphones. Previously, the phone was able to make calls, send messages, transmit data via Bluetooth, was equipped with a simple accelerometer and a simple camera. Today, using a smartphone, you can pay for purchases, verify your identity, measure your heart rate, and so on. APIs are used to create applications with access to these features of mobile devices. For such an interface to work correctly with every smartphone, it must be configured correctly and must be tested. This increases the overall development time and affects the final cost.

Individual design

Typically, designers and developers use Apple and Google guidelines. A guideline is a kind of set of rules that determines how to interface elements should look and work so that they can be conveniently used on different smartphones. But sometimes the customer wants the application to look different from what everyone is used to.

To create a unique user interface design, you need to do some serious business intelligence and involve professionals in the field of UI and UX design. The immersion of analysts and project managers in analyzing the business processes of the future application also incurs additional costs.


Mobile app development for iOS and Android is very different. These platforms use different programming languages ​​and development tools, so programmers with different skills and experience are needed.

Server-side and database

The server part or backend is a system for exchanging information between the application and the customer’s database. For example, the backend ensures data synchronization between inventory balances in the online store and the customer’s warehouse, participates in making payments and processing bookings.

A standard application is created on average in 18 weeks, that is, in 4 months.

iOS development is faster and cheaper in terms of fragmentation. Android has many versions and many devices (24,000 different Android devices from over 1,200 manufacturers). This complicates the development and testing of the application, which is costly and time-consuming. Only Apple uses OC iOS and has a limited number of smartphones and tablets.

Conclusion: iOS and Android development take about the same time. However, the situation with Android becomes more complicated if you develop an application for a large arsenal of devices. Therefore, choose the most popular flagships of the market and make a project for them, since your project will look and work badly on low-quality devices.

Where can mobile app development lead your business?

Mobile app development is one of the number one priorities for any business and enterprise. As customer behavior changes, businesses continue to improve their policies to earn customer happiness. With the increasing public use of smartphones, there has been a significant boom in the experience of e-commerce and mobile banking. A mobile app is needed to run a business successfully, and now its importance is greater than ever. A mobile app is not only a mobile version of your website but a critical engagement and experience-driven environment that is essential to a consolidated customer journey. A mobile app can help build a strong presence and attract a large audience for your services or products.

What are the latest mobile app development trends in 2021?

Technological trends have become increasingly difficult when you are busy driving the strategy of your business. That’s why we have compiled the list of the most effective upcoming trends in mobile app development for you. Take a look:

1. Artificial Intelligence & Machine Learning

If you are a tech-gig, then you might be aware of these terminologies – Artificial Intelligence and Machine Learning.

However, on a daily basis, people use AI and ML on their smartphones every day. But in 2021, android app development trends are going to have even more AI-based features like chatbots, voice translators, and smart predictions.

2. Chatbots

Chatbots are digital applications that simulate the human way of conversation to guide users or answer their questions. Over the years, chatbots have become more smarter and advanced. Therefore, the demand for chatbots on websites has increased, too.

As per the report, 58% of businesses using chatbots belong to the B2B field. So, if your business is into online shopping, food delivery, online cab booking, etc then integrating your app with chatbots can help you save plenty of time.

3. Android Jetpack

Android Jetpack is a cluster of libraries and tools and guidelines that help developers build advanced android apps that can perform in the real world. The main purpose of this set is to simplify routine development tasks.

4. Internet of Things

Integrating the Internet of Things (IoT) in android app development has been utilized by many companies nowadays. As per the report, the IoT market can reach up to $1.6 trillion in 2025.

5. On-Demand Apps

One of the major trends for android app development is improving customer services and experience with the help of on-demand apps. The on-demand app is a booming trend in android app development and it’s the more likely rule in 2021.

The on-demand apps help users to do everyday tasks faster and more conveniently. The apps help users to buy things at their doorstep.

6. Accelerated Mobile Pages

Accelerator Mobile Pages (AMP) is a light version of HTML which is used to increase the speed of mobile pages. It enables developers to develop heavy web applications and websites with high performance. In fact, AMP-driven websites will also be listed in mobile search results.

7. Kotlin

Kotlin runs on Java Virtual Machine, which offers a new exciting feature to developers for multi-platform projects. It’s still an experimental feature available in Kotlin 1.2 and 1.3, but we think it’s going to become really big in 2021.


The 2021 year is going to be interesting. There is a rise in various trends and technologies and everything will revolve around the customers.

However, apart from the mentioned seven trends, there are many more android app development trends that we might have missed on. But remember one thing, not every trend will add value to your business.

Implementing android app development trends will make your business race ahead of your competitors and also 2021 will surely bring some changes in the mobile app development process.

If you are still unaware, you can contact the android or iphone app development company, we continuously upgrade ourselves with the trends and technologies and our developers will implement the trends in your android app for better growth.

What are the top mobile app development companies in demand?

Almost every web development company builds mobile apps for small-medium to large-sized businesses. Choosing the right one for your business is always a hectic process for everyone.

You should need to consider various points before hiring an app development company

  • Company experience
  • Reputation
  • Past work
  • Team size
  • Work transparency
  • Client’s feedback

To help you, here I have shared a list of the best mobile app development companies which will help you to finalize the one for your business app.
This list of best app development companies has created after in-depth research of the app development market.

How can a college student start freelancing in mobile app development?

Considering you have at least an elementary knowledge of the same, you can start with freelancing websites such as Fiverr, Upwork, Freelancer and likes.

In college vacations as well, you can do short term internships with app development companies to gain a better exposure and industry experience.

I hope this helps.

What steps can I take to become both a mobile app developer and a desktop app developer?

(1) Learn computer programming. (Not <name of some programming language> programming, computer programming. Taught in English. [You won’t be able to think in a computer language for many years.])

(2) This should take you about 2 years.
(3) Learn the programming languages you’ll need for the apps you’ll be developing – Swift for iOS, Java for Android, SQL for most databases, etc.

Get a job as a programmer, and stick with it for about 5 years.
Now you’re ready to develop apps on your own. About 5 years of that and you might actually find yourself developing parts of a program directly in a programming language. Congratulations – you are now a good professional software developer.